Patient transported after possible stroke on Silas Creek PkwyWinston Salem NC

As discussed during the dispatch call, paramedics transported an elderly woman from a medical office near Silas Creek Parkway to Forsyth Medical Center. She showed possible stroke symptoms, including facial droop, slurred speech, and mild weakness. Her blood pressure was elevated, and her blood sugar was normal. She had no known history of stroke or use of blood thinners.
